28 men charged in kidnappings at Philippine plywood plant
MANILA - Police filed kidnapping cases against Abu Sayyaf extremists said to be behind the abduction of three factory workers, including two Chinese nationals, in Maluso, Basilan last week, according to ABS-CBN News.

Police were said to be seeking the safe return of the kidnapping victims, all employees at the Basilan Hi-Tech Woodcraft Ind. Plywood plant. The kidnappings occurred Nov. 10.
